Cultivating Inner Strength: Resources for Support and Growth
Your mental health is paramount. It affects your overall well-being and skill to thrive in various aspects of life. If you're facing challenges or simply seeking ways to improve your mental wellness, know that you're not alone and there are valuable resources available to guide you on your journey.
Engage with a trusted friend, family member, or therapist. Sharing your feelings and experiences can be incredibly helpful.
Consider joining a support group where you can connect with others who understand what you're going through. These groups provide a safe and supportive space to share your thoughts and receive valuable insights.
Explore mindfulness techniques such as deep breathing exercises or yoga to reduce anxiety and promote a sense of peace.
Prioritize self-care activities that bring you joy and restore your energy, such as spending time in nature, pursuing hobbies, or listening to uplifting music.
Remember, requesting help is a sign of strength, not weakness. By embracing these resources, you can nurture your mental well-being and thrive a more fulfilling life.
